Are you still using your awesome homemade HearthKit? I tried it this weekend. I unfortunately put my tiles on the oven base and and at 550, the tiles got up to 680 and burned the bottom of my pizza. On the second pizza, I changed the temp to 450 and my tiles got to around 550 and the bottom turned out great but the top wasn't as crispy as I wanted (even though the kids liked it).
I know what I need to do, I think, but wanted to talk to you. I am going to move my tiles up to the middle of my oven and preheat at 550 - as you illustrate. The tiles should get at around 550. But I wanted to know if you still put the oven on broil as soon as put your pizza in? I am afraid it will burn the top of my pizza but I'm up for it if does the trick. I think I need to have the top of my oven at around 700 to have the top crust brown nicely but not quite sure how to go about producing that kind of heat.
